97 town car limo needs rear end replacement

Asked by traceyslimo May 09, 2014 at 12:41 PM about the 1997 Lincoln Town Car Executive

Question type: Maintenance & Repair

I can't find a rear end w/limo pkg for under 1500. Do I have to have a limo pkg rear end or can I use a rear end from a 90-97 car and just change to 32 spline ?

2 Answers

57,955

I'm not aware of a Limo Package Rear-end although, I haven't dealt with many Limousines (gratefully). You wouldn't believe some of the hack-jobs. I'd change up to the 32 spline - for no other reason than the axles are easier to get. It's just an 8.8" Ford isn't it? Do you have the tag off of the diff? It would be interesting to see.
